This set of four utility boxes stands in front of Original Joe's restaurant. The boxes are wrapped with photographic quality scenes visible at this intersection. Each of the four sides portrays the matching scene along the street when viewed from that side. I tried to get photos showing how the boxes blend into the background.

When viewing these boxes from the street, looking towards Joe's, one can barely detect the boxes, as the scene depicted on the boxes closely matches the actual view of Joes restaurant. Two of the boxes depict the gray stone planter boxes of Joe's. The other boxes match the red brick of Joe's building and a window. If you look closely you can see the ventilation louvers of the boxes themselves.

The Original Joe's side of the utility boxes can be seen in Google Street View.

Standing on the sidewalk in front of Joe's and looking towards the street, the scene looks just like the buildings across the street from Joe's. The two end boxes show views looking up and down the street in front of Joe's.

This is part of a new project in San Jose, using box wraps. Four photographs are taken facing each of the directions from where the utility boxes stand. These images are placed on a thin material that is adhered to the box, so that it blends into the scenery in a way. Standing on any of the four sides and looking in the direction of the box, one sees the same street scene as depicted on the side of the utility box.
